Output 83c185514bbb664ce92a5c179cca7b2345caef27f5d2ee5a15f491b46d403dc7:0
- value
- 70366226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7cb8763aa2afc50213eef1b67e36c6067615182 OP_EQUAL
- address
- 3NpdqHmpjqHodepsbVg1PQ8HdCZ9ZqShJK
- transaction
- 83c185514bbb664ce92a5c179cca7b2345caef27f5d2ee5a15f491b46d403dc7
- confirmations
- 444935
- spent
- true